Five essential WordPress plugins to get you started

I’ve gathered five plugins worth exploring for your first WordPress project in a neat list below:

Google Analytics for WordPress - Easy implementation and even easier to tie together with your Google Analytics account. If you happen to manage several accounts, then it will simply request which one to connect to via a drop down. Easy peasy!

All in one SEO pack - Comes with a range of benefits such as automatic optimisation of page titles and so forth (all mangble from one point) but will also give you the option to fine tune settings per page (title, description and keywords) and more.

Facebook like button – You download and install the plugin and voila -  the buttons appear perfectly in the bottom of each post. Not much more effort needed then that.

SI CAPATCHA – Anti SPAM – I got swamped with SPAM comments throughout all my WordPress blogs and websites, until I found this, and it put a stop to the floodgates of innaporriate and irrelevant comments almost immediately.

Portfolio slideshow – Easy slideshow with sufficient functionality to showcase/let visitors browse your photographs in a modern manner.
